Class lecture notes for third Year,sixth semester Principles of Compiler Design ( Subject Code: CS) is available here in PDF formats for. CS/CS62/CS Principles of Compiler Design For All Subject Notes -Click Here CSE 6th Semester Regulation | BE Computer Science and. Anna University 6th Semester CSE Computer Science & Engineering Notes, Question Bank, Question Papers, 2&16 Marks, Important Questions, CS

Author: Moogujind Sashicage
Country: Bolivia
Language: English (Spanish)
Genre: Automotive
Published (Last): 28 August 2008
Pages: 310
PDF File Size: 15.33 Mb
ePub File Size: 13.10 Mb
ISBN: 880-8-39227-546-9
Downloads: 1618
Price: Free* [*Free Regsitration Required]
Uploader: Kesida

Give an example for eliminating the same.

Note for Compiler Design – CD By Dr. D. Jagadeesan

Leave a Reply Cancel reply Enter your comment here A convenient noges is in the form of a syntax tree. Some examples of such tools include: Mention the limitations of static allocation.

Construct Predictive Parsing table for the following grammar: Anna University — B. Touch here to read.

Debugging or Optimizing Compiler. Give the annotated parse tree for the assignment x: Give the applications of dags. Analysis of Source Program: Explain with an example.


A Compiler operates in phases, each of which transforms the source program from one representation to another. Describe the Analysis Synthesis Model ckmpiler compilation. Mention the different types of parameter passing.

Text from page-2 Anna University — B. Give the situations in which stack allocation can not be used.

CS PRINCIPLES OF COMPILER DESIGN Lecture Notes for CSE – Sixth (6th) Semester – by han

Explain in detail 8 b What is a three address code? How would you generate intermediate code for the flow of control statements? What are machine idioms?

Mention the transformations that are characteristic of peephole optimizations. This site uses cookies.

Principles of compiler design – PCD – CS – Anna university – CSE – 6th semester – question bank

Explain the various phases of compiler in detail, with a neat sketch. Explain briefly the producer consumer pair of a lexical analyzer and parser. November 30, at Interpreters 8 b Write in detail about the cousins of the compiler. The analysis phase breaks up the source program into constituent pieces and creates an intermediate representation of the source program. Explain the phases in detail. What are register descriptors? What are the three general approaches to the implementation of a Lexical Analyzer?


Notify me of new comments via email. Email required Address never made public. Give its impact on programs. This process is known as parsing.

Text from fompiler Anna University — B. Write down the output of each phase for the expression a: Certain tokens will be augmented by a lexical value.

Give the triple representation of a ternary operation x: